Description

A flaw has been found in bolo-blog bolo-solo up to 2.6.4. This affects the function importFromMarkdown of the file src/main/java/org/b3log/solo/bolo/prop/BackupService.java of the component Filename Handler. Executing a manipulation of the argument File can lead to path traversal. The attack may be performed from remote. The exploit has been published and may be used. The project was informed of the problem early through an issue report but has not responded yet.

Analysis

Path traversal in Bolo Solo's importFromMarkdown function allows authenticated attackers to manipulate file paths and access arbitrary files on affected systems. The vulnerability affects Bolo Solo versions up to 2.6.4 and requires valid credentials but no user interaction to exploit. …
